TD Newcrest (assumes coverage and) downgraded DragonWave (NASDAQ: DRWI) from Buy to Hold. PT cut from $10 to $8.

TD analyst says, "Q4 results were in line on revenue; EPS reflected the lack of large customer deployments. We see mobile providers upgrading backhaul links (estimated at 30% of the network cost) in response to data growth, and DragonWave is a leading independent provider of high-capacity microwave backhaul solutions. Our rationale for downgrading to HOLD is 1) lack of visibility on the timing and magnitude of known large opportunities; 2) Q1/12 guidance that implies the balance of the business remains below the Q2/11 revenue peak, despite impressive new customer growth; and 3) little clarity around the ultimate earnings power of the business."

Shares of DragonWave closed at $7.28 yesterday.
